Nicholas & Company praised for promoting local products
Commitment to green agriculture
Utah Commissioner of Agriculture and Food, Leonard Blackham, and Mountainland Apples, Inc. Sales Manager, Marv Rowley offered special recognition and praise to Nicholas & Company for offering Utah grown fruits and vegetables to their food service customers.
Commissioner Blackham and Rowley presented a specially designed award to company President, Peter Mouskondis during ceremonies June 26th.
“I commend Nicholas & Company for recognizing the importance of offering Utah products to its consumers,” said Blackham. “Your company is not only supporting Utah farmers, but offering a high quality, nutritious and safe product to Utahns,” he added.
“As costs continue to rise and consumers become more demanding of "green" products, Nicholas & Company recognizes the importance of purchasing and promoting locally grown products when it is available, “said Marv Rowley. “Each box of fruit purchased helps keep and create new jobs here. Purchasing locally also helps to maintain quality and keep transportation costs down,” he added
The Utah Department of Agriculture and Food’s Marketing department promotes local agriculture though it’s highly successful Utah’s Own program.
